  4. Big difference between walking nobody (or few) and “command”. To me, command is locating the ball properly, not loosely throwing it into the strike zone. He’s got good enough stuff! His command is mediocre, particularly with his changeup. He continually threw his fastball center of the plate, 6” below & 4” above the zone. Intentionally, I think! Eventually, (grand slam) a guy will sit on that pitch if ahead in the count. Maybe mixed results for the hitter but it’s an increased opportunity for the batter. Up and in, or even better, down and away or down and in off the plate, (any variation) occasionally, makes everything more effective. He gave up a high, center cut fastball for granny & then, in next at bat, hung a change in the middle of the plate. “Strikes” but with poor command! I think most of the issue is immaturity and developing between his ears, not physical capability. He was shaking off Vazquez and throwing fastballs like he was Nolan Ryan - it caught up to him. …….I think his future is solid, just needs to gather himself and be smarter pitch to pitch and in less of a hurry.
